Job Summary

Join our customer's dynamic team as an Asamese Bilingual Expert, leveraging your expertise in both Asamese and English to deliver complex language solutions. In this impactful role, you will help transcribe and analyze video content, ensuring linguistic accuracy and cultural authenticity.

Key Responsibilities
  • Transcribe Asamese video content with precise timestamps and clear formatting.
  • Analyze and describe the emotional tone and intent of speakers, capturing subtle cues and context.
  • Evaluate grammar, word usage, and tone, providing detailed feedback and linguistic insights.
  • Define conceptual meanings of words and idiomatic expressions, ensuring clarity and depth.
  • Perform advanced language tasks such as contextual analysis and semantic breakdowns.
  • Collaborate with team members to optimize transcription processes and language resources.
  • Maintain high standards of confidentiality, accuracy, and professionalism throughout all tasks.
  • Required

    Skills and Qualifications
  • Native or near-native proficiency in both Asamese and English, with exceptional written and verbal communication skills.
  • Proven experience in transcription, translation, or comprehensive language analysis.
  • Deep understanding of Asamese grammar, vocabulary, and cultural nuances.
  • Strong attention to detail and ability to deliver high-quality linguistic work under deadlines.
  • Demonstrated ability to analyze emotionality and tone in spoken language.
  • Familiarity with digital collaboration tools and remote work best practices.
  • Willingness to commit at least 15 hours per week to customer projects.
  •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ience working with multimedia content or localization projects.
  • Academic background in linguistics, language studies, or a related field.
  • Prior exposure to complex language tasks for diverse, multilingual teams.
